   Many second graders are beginning to use many strategies independently to figure out new words, including sounding out longer words and thinking about what makes sense in the sentence. They may be reading longer books and relying less on pictures to help them read the story. Books with familiar characters can help make thos transition into longer books easier. Pausing after every 2 or 3 pages to briefly retell what is happening can help your child as s/he keeps track of a longer story. Even though your child is becoming independent as a reader, it is still important to continue to read aloud books together. Listening to stories is a stress-free way to help your child build vocabulary and comprehension strategies. It is also a wonderful way to spend time together!

 

MAGAZINES:

- Ranger Rick or National Geographic Kids

 

SERIES:

- Curious George books by H.A. Rey

- Cam Jansen books by David A. Adler

- Junie B. Jones books by Barbara Park

- Horrible Harry books by Suzy Kline

- Arthur books by Marc Brown

-Poppleton books by Cynthia Rylant

- Franklin books by Sharon Jennings

- Nate the Great books by Marjorie Weinman Sharmat

- A Little House Birthday and other Little House picture books adapted from Laura Ingalls Wilder

- Berenstain Bears by Stan & Jan Berestain

- Stablemates by various authors

- Magic Treehouse books by Mary Pope Osborne
